Study on discrete surfaces with constant principal curvature for nanocarbon applications.
problem Understanding discrete geometry properties of nanocarbon materials.
method Developed discrete surface theory on 3-ary oriented trees, defined discrete principal directions, constructed examples of discrete CPC surfaces.
result Construction of discrete constant principal curvature surfaces, including discrete CPC tori.
Study of convex hypersurfaces with specific curvature properties.
problem Characterizing convex hypersurfaces with vanishing Weyl curvature and semi-parallel cubic form.
method Analyzing locally strongly convex affine hypersurfaces with vanishing Weyl curvature tensor and semi-parallel cubic form relative to the Levi-Civita connection of affine metric.
result Classification of such hypersurfaces, excluding flat affine metric cases.

The second boundary value problem of the prescribed affine mean curvature equation is a nonlinear, fourth order, geometric partial differential equation.
